Cultural Conditioning
The conversation delves into the pervasive cultural beliefs that drive individuals to constantly compete and chase after fleeting opportunities. Julie shares her experience of stepping back from social media, highlighting the importance of aligning with one's true self amidst societal pressures. This introspective break serves as a reminder to prioritize authenticity over the relentless hustle.In this clip
